BYD
BYD Seal U DM-i review
There are many reasons why car companies expend so much time and energy creating brand-appropriate nomenclature, including providing prospective buyers…
The best fleet information source in the UK
There are many reasons why car companies expend so much time and energy creating brand-appropriate nomenclature, including providing prospective buyers…